Mosquitoes are attracted to humans primarily due to the carbon dioxide we exhale, as well as certain chemicals present in our sweat, such as lactic acid and uric acid. These chemicals serve as a beacon to the mosquitoes, making them more likely to land on us. Traditional mosquito repellents, such as DEET, work by masking these odors, thereby confusing the mosquitoes and preventing them from targeting their host.
